About Jonathan Slator

Jonathon Slator was nominated by his peers, Location Managers’ Guild International, for “Hell or High Water”.

Jonathan has spent the vast majority of his working life in the production of all forms of film and television from major motion pictures to low budget independent features, from television series and one off plays for the BBC to episodics and reality shows in America and Australia, and from commercials to infomercials to training videos. He has been paid (but not always credited due to union issues) as producer, production manager, segment director, stunt driver, first and second assistant director, camera assistant and clapper loader, floor manager, actor, location scout, location manager and of course earlier in his career as PA. He has worked projects on all continents except Antarctica.
